Top Activities and Local Experiences for Families in Hanstholm
Hanstholm and the surrounding Thy coast offer a wealth of activities that suit family rhythms—from energetic mornings on the beach to calm afternoons exploring nature and local culture. Here are some family-friendly experiences that align with a safety-conscious, convenience-focused approach to travel:
- Beach days with gentle shorelines: Hanstholm’s beaches provide wide sandy areas and shallow waters ideal for families. Pack swimsuits, sunscreen, and a small shade tent for mid-day breaks to keep everyone comfortable.
- Coastal walks and dune adventures: Easy-access trails along the coast allow kids to collect shells, observe seabirds, and learn about dune ecosystems. Bring binoculars for a quick birding session and a nature journal for a keepsake activity.
- Hanstholm Lighthouse and coastal viewpoints: A visit to the lighthouse offers dramatic sea views and an opportunity to learn about maritime navigation. It’s a safe, scenic stop that also makes for great family photos.
- Nature reserves and Thy National Park: The region’s protected areas showcase unique coastal flora and fauna. Family-friendly boardwalks and short loops make these spots accessible for younger children as well as seniors in the group.
- Boat trips and seal watching: Local operators offer short boat excursions along the coast, giving families a chance to see marine life and enjoy a different perspective of the water. Always follow safety guidance from the captain and wear life jackets when provided.
- Fishing and harbor experiences: Some local harbors offer friendly introductions to beginner fishing or early morning markets where families can observe daily routines, sample local flavors, and pick up fresh ingredients for in-camp meals.
- Local culture and cuisine: Danish baked goods, fish specialties, and family-friendly eateries provide tasty breaks. Food tours or casual dining at kid-friendly venues help keep little ones happy and rested.
- Seasonal events and markets: Check local calendars for seasonal markets or family-oriented festivals that highlight Danish traditions, crafts, and music—great opportunities to engage with locals and create lasting memories.
Practical Tips for a Safe and Convenient Hanstholm Vacation
Effective planning makes a Hanstholm trip smoother and more enjoyable for everyone. This practical checklist focuses on safety, ease, and comfort for families staying in vacation rentals or Glamping Tent Accommodation.
- Plan ahead for weather variability: coastal Denmark can be breezy and cooler, even in summer. Pack layers, windproof jackets, and rain-friendly gear so adventures aren’t dampened by a sudden change in weather.
- Safety basics on arrival: verify stove and heating controls, confirm the location of first-aid kits, and identify the nearest hospital or medical facility. Ensure the accommodation has child-safe locks or gates where appropriate.
- Stroller and mobility planning: choose trails and beaches with smooth paths where strollers can travel comfortably. Some glamping sites offer flat, shaded entryways that make kid logistics easier.
- Meal planning and groceries: identify nearby supermarkets or grocery delivery options to minimize extra trips. If staying in a Glamping Tent, check what cooking facilities are available and stock up on easy-to-prepare meals for busy days.
- Power and water considerations: coastal areas may have occasional weather-related disruptions. Have a small supply of bottled water, and plan for backup charging options for devices in case of power outages.
- Daily packing routine: snacks, sun protection, hats, and a lightweight day bag make excursions more enjoyable and less stressful for parents who are juggling bags, gear, and kids’ needs.
- Adaptability: flexibility is key with kids. Build in rest time back at the accommodation, and consider alternative indoor activities if a day isn’t ideal for outdoor play.

Getting There, Getting Around, and Local Logistics
Hanstholm is best accessed by car, which provides the most flexibility for families with children and gear. A road trip from major Danish cities typically involves coastal scenery and manageable driving times, with options to stop at small towns for meals or a quick stretch. Parking near most vacation rentals and Glamping Tent sites is commonly available, and many accommodations provide detailed directions and loading zones for easy unloading with kids. In the off-season, it’s common to find quieter streets and fewer crowds, which can be ideal for families who prefer a slower pace and more room to explore safely at their own rhythm.
Public transport options exist but can require planning around the timetable. If arriving by train or bus, it’s advisable to arrange local transfers in advance or choose a stay within a short walk or short taxi ride from the station or bus stop. When planning day trips to nearby towns within Thy—such as Thisted or Hjørring—a flexible schedule helps to accommodate younger travelers’ mealtimes and nap windows.
